    I have two showers in my house. Four years ago both showers dripped due to hard water buildup. We…read moredecided to fix one of them (all we could afford). The plumber at that time (different company) had to schedule a second visit so he could order a new faucet since he had to break the existing nut to remove it. Total cost about $400. We finally had the funds to do the other shower last week. Kastle plumbing came out with replacement nut and cartridge on the truck. Again, he had to break the nut to remove the mechanics, but since he had a replacement nut, he didn't have to order an entire new faucet. One visit, 25 minutes, $162. The guys were professional, explained what they were going to do, and no more dripping!

    WARNING: They threatened to "put a lien on the house" when I questioned their pricing…read more I'm 45 years old, have lived in three 100-year-old homes, and have never before left a negative review for a contractor. I hired Honey Go Fix It to reseat a toilet. I chose them because of their 4.9 Google rating and promise of a free estimate. When the plumber arrived, I approved and signed an estimate on a small phone screen. I trusted what he was telling me and was not shown the actual dollar amount displayed clearly on the screen before signing. The technician completed the work in less than 20 minutes and then showed me a bill for $481.65. I was stunned. A wax ring costs about $10 and no other materials were needed. The price was astronomical for the work performed. The verbal quote was mumbled and unclear. When I saw $481.65 on the final bill, I genuinely thought there was a mistake. I declined to pay immediately and called the office to resolve it. Here's where it really went wrong. I spoke to Kassandra, the President of the company, to discuss the situation. Within the first two minutes, before I could even fully explain what happened, she threatened to file a lien on my house if I didn't pay immediately. I offered to pay $300 to resolve it amicably. That's still $900/hour for 20 minutes of work with a $10 part. Kassandra refused via email, claiming their responsibility is to "maintain fair and consistent pricing," while simultaneously admitting that they are "adding extra clarity steps during the estimate approval process to help prevent future misunderstandings." Consistent pricing? Maybe. Fair? Absolutely not. The owner acknowledged in writing that their current process causes confusion. Yet, she still demanded full payment and threatened our property rights. Being immediately threatened with a lien on our house for simply asking questions destroyed any chance of restoring trust in her company. I paid the invoice to avoid the hassle of a lien, but I'm leaving this review so others can protect themselves. If you use this company: 1. Get the total dollar amount in writing, on paper, in large readable text, before you sign anything. 2. Research what competing plumbers charge for the same work. 3. If you can't clearly see the price or feel rushed or pressured, do not sign. This company has lost my business and recommendation. I hope this review helps you make an informed choice.
